When Molin cranks the machine up, 2,000 marbles are pulled to the top on little elevators. He programs the machine using belts made of LEGO Technic pieces. The pins open gates that allow marbles to drop onto the machine's built-in vibraphone (a xylophone with a wavering sound), drums, cymbal, or bass guitar in time with the music.

Either way, glue these strips into three-sided troughs, as shown in the plans. A few scraps of 3/4"-thick plywood make great spacers to keep the sides parallel. Despite your best efforts, the bottom of each trough may slide around during glue-up. To fix this, set your jointer to make a very fine cut, then run the dried trough blanks over it.

A Marble Machine is a creative ball-run contraption, made from familiar materials, designed to send a rolling marble through tubes and funnels, across tracks and bumpers, and into a catch at the end. We often suggest a goal of getting the marble to travel from the top of the board to a target at the bottom as slowly as possible.
